Col . Anthony Pollio , the commander of U . S . Army Garrison Fort Leonard Wood , spoke at a town hall meeting for garrison employees on January 17th at Nutter Field House . The next town hall meeting for employees will be held on April 17th . Garrison leaders at Fort Leonard Wood recently hosted a town hall meeting for civilian employees . Col . Anthony Pollio started off the event by expressing gratitude to everyone for attending and then invited Command Sgt . Maj . Danny Castleberry to join him on stage to recognize some outstanding employees . They recognized Joe Johnson Jr . for his 35 years of service , as well as Douglas Singleton II and Guy Caley for their 25 years of service . Several other employees were also acknowledged for their excellent work . Angela Merritt , Bryan Enicar , Shannon Suarez , Marc Machado , Patrick Riggins , and Samantha Marler were among those recognized . Pollio mentioned that the senior leadership appreciates all the hard work of the employees and thanked them for supporting the mission . The next agenda item was the upcoming changes to the operating hours of the West and South gates . Pollio explained that due to a shortage of civilian gate guards , military personnel have been assigned to work at the gates , impacting the training brigades ' ability to carry out their primary mission . As a result , the commanding general decided to reduce the gate hours . Starting from February 1st , the West Gate will operate from 5 a . m . to 9 p . m . daily , and the South Gate will be open from 4 a . m . to 9 p . m . daily . Pollio also mentioned that the Department of Emergency Services team is working on allowing emergency responders access outside of normal operating hours . Two off - post town hall meetings are scheduled for individuals to discuss the gate changes with civic leaders in the area . Pollio emphasized that Fort Leonard Wood senior leaders will gather feedback about gate access and reassess the situation after 60 days . He also addressed job vacancies on post , stating that the majority of vacancies are in the Child Development Centers . Efforts are being made to hire more people and reduce turnover in that area .
